FET price has seen significant price action recently, driven in part by shifting market sentiment following CUDOS’ addition to the Artificial Superintelligence Alliance (ASI). Despite this development, some concerns have emerged regarding FET’s price potential. One of the key factors is the increasing participation of short-term holders, whose activity could potentially introduce volatility. As these investors enter the market, FET may face challenges in sustaining its bullish trajectory. Should FET Holders Worry? The rise of short-term holders on the ASI network is becoming a growing concern. These investors, who typically hold FET for less than a month, now control over 9% of the cryptocurrency’s circulating supply from 5.6% last month. While short-term holders aren’t currently dominating the market, their increasing presence could spell trouble for FET if they decide to book profits quickly. Although they have not yet led to significant bearishness, the collective actions of these short-term holders could weigh on FET’s price. If the market shifts and these investors move to liquidate their positions, it might create downward pressure, leading to a temporary dip in FET’s price before any sustained rally can take place. Source: IntoTheBlock From a technical perspective, the ASI token is showing signs of building bullish momentum. The 50-day and 200-day exponential moving averages (EMAs) are on the verge of forming a Golden Cross, a bullish indicator that could signal the end of the current Death Cross, which has been active since mid-July. This potential shift would likely reinvigorate market confidence in FET, creating a foundation for further price growth. The Death Cross has kept the market cautious over the past few months, but the possible formation of a Golden Cross could reverse this trend.
